Company Summary

Stellar Energy is a trusted provider of turnkey liquid-to-chip cooling solutions for the world’s leading data center and industrial manufacturing customers. As computing demand and industrial processes continue to grow, modern facilities require cooling infrastructure that can scale quickly, efficiently, and reliably.

Our modular approach enables high-volume production while maintaining the flexibility to customize each solution. From Central Utility Plants to Coolant Distribution Units, Stellar Energy delivers scalable cooling infrastructure designed to support the rapid expansion of data centers and mission-critical industrial operations.

Backed by deep engineering expertise and large-scale manufacturing capability, Stellar Energy helps customers deploy critical infrastructure faster and with confidence.

Summary Objective

The Chief Engineer is a cross-functional systems expert with knowledge and capability across the range of engineering disciplines required by Stellar Energy’s offerings. The role engages with customers and the engineering team to understand, document, and deliver optimized solutions for client needs. The role is primarily focused on the front-end of solution development, but provides support of engineering programs executed by cross-functional teams.

The primary responsibility of the Chief Engineer is to lead the technical development, performance, and execution of modular cooling solutions and modular central utility plants for data centers and industrial markets. This includes ownership of the engineering lifecycle from concept development through design support, project execution, commissioning support, and post-handover technical support. This is accomplished by leading and developing application engineers, self-executing new and complex analyses, and influencing the design of thermal and utility systems to ensure the ideal solution is delivered to the customer.

This role will lead a team of application engineers responsible for translating customer inputs into engineering program requirements and remaining engaged throughout project execution as key cross-functional technical decision-makers.

Required Education and Experience.

    • Bachelor of Science degree in Engineering, preferably Mechanical or Chemical, from an accredited university
    • Significant experience in thermal systems, cooling systems, central utility plant design, or related engineered infrastructure solutions
    • Experience supporting data center, industrial, mission-critical, or utility-related projects
    • Experience with:
      • Chilled water system equipment and performance
      • Cooling plant design and optimization
      • Energy storage principles, with specific knowledge of chilled water thermal energy storage
      • Thermodynamic cycles, including Brayton, Rankine, vapor-compression, and vapor-absorption
      • Modular equipment and packaged plant solutions
    • Advanced skills with:
      • Microsoft Excel, including macros and VBA
      • Performance modeling and engineering analysis tools
      • Weather/climatic data collection and statistical analysis
